Talent Acquisition Specialist

Remote with a potential for Hybrid Work Module


Although we don’t have a current opening for this specific role, we’re always excited to meet passionate candidates who align with our mission. Apply today to join our Talent Network, and we’ll reach out when a position becomes available that fits your background and goals.


D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• The duties shall include, but are not limited to, the following:
  • Full Cycle Recruitment
  • Manages the recruiting process through the ATS from job description development and ad placement to communication to recruits and schools of hiring decisions.
  • Reviews resumes as they are received schedule phone screens, virtual interviews
  • Consult with hiring managers about which candidates may be the most worthwhile to pursue, schedule on site interviews for the hiring managers.
  • Execute Offer Letters
  • New Hire Onboarding
  • New Hire Orientation
  • Manages the administrative end of our ATS – accesses, permissions, add-on features, etc.
  • Trains all Directors/Assistant Directors on our ATS
  • Create and produce reports tracking recruiting efforts.
  • Performs all such related and non-related duties as may be assigned from time to time.

REPORTS TO: Talent Manager

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or’s degree preferred
  • Two to five years’ experience in talent acquisition. Background in recruiting and employee relations required.
  • Experience working with an Applicant Tracking System (ATS) and familiarity with HRIS & Payroll system
  • Excellent verbal, written and interpersonal skills with the ability to initiate and maintain working relationships with all levels of staff.
  •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ail.
  • Must reside in the Tri-State area (New Jersey, New York, or Connecticut) to ensure accessibility to our campuses and participation in occasional in-person leadership meetings or events.
